YOUR ROLE

We lead the digitisation of global manufacturing and asset intensive companies across a broad range of industries including Consumer Goods, Aerospace & Defence, Life Sciences and Energy Transition & Utilities. Our blend of strategy, transformation, engineering and cloud skills makes us unique in our field. We work with many multi-national clients, using our scale and breadth of skills to grow Smart Asset projects from Proof of Concept through to adoption at-scale.

As a Director in our Intelligent Industry practice you will lead the sales and delivery of projects to create autonomous operations for our clients through the adoption of digital technologies and AI. You will work with leaders in Operations and Engineering functions to define the digitisation strategy, calculate the business case, design the transformation roadmap to achieve the strategy and lead client teams in adopting new ways of working. You will lead teams of consultants working closely with operators and technicians to make changes sustainable thus assuring long-term benefits.

Our consultants typically work directly alongside our clients at their sites, keeping the focus of digitisation on the user experience and the business outcomes. As a Director, you will build teams to deliver such projects and take responsibility for the personal and professional development of the practitioners. You will typically work with colleagues from Capgemini’s Engineering, Data and Cloud Services businesses and frog, our Digital Agency. You will lead teams collaborating to design, build and implement digital solutions that enable our clients to improve service levels, reduce costs and improve sustainability outcomes. As part of the Intelligent Industry extended leadership team you will share responsibility for the growth of our practice and practitioners.

As an Industry 4.0 & Connected Assets leader you will play a key role in:

  • Growing Capgemini Invent’s business through building our Industrial Asset Management capabilities;
  • Developing our people through training the next generation of consulting leaders;
  • Building the competitiveness and resilience of our clients in their marketplaces; and
  • Leading the adoption of AI and associated transformation of business models in key sectors of the UK economy.

As part of your role you will also have the opportunity to contribute to the business and your own personal growth, through activities that form part of the following categories:

  • Business Development – Leading/contributing to proposals, RFPs, bids, proposition development, client pitch contribution, client hosting at events.
  • Internal contribution – Campaign development, internal think-tanks, whitepapers, practice development (operations, recruitment, team events & activities), offering development.
  • Learning & development – Training to support your career development and the skills demand within the company, certifications etc.

YOUR PROFILE

We are looking for a candidate at Director level, or ready to make that step, who can demonstrate:

  • A background in transforming manufacturing and/or utilities operations to deliver a step-change in performance in asset intensive industries through the implementation of digital technologies and AI;
  • The business acumen and skills to create compelling business cases for investment and change;
  • A passion for leading operational improvements with a focus on employee engagement and empowerment; and
  • Proven ability to be successful in a matrixed organization through enlisting support and commitment from peers in selling and delivering consulting solutions;
  • Currently working in a major Consulting firm, and/or in industry but having a Consulting background
  • Business development – utilising a combination of the organisation’s broader pre-existing relationships, company relationships and your own network, you’ll be generating c.£2m of annual consulting revenues.

ABOUT CAPGEMINI

Capgemini is an AI-powered global business and technology transformation partner, delivering tangible business value. We imagine the future of organizations and make it real with AI, technology and people. With our strong heritage of nearly 60 years, we are a responsible and diverse group of over 420,000 team members in more than 50 countries. We deliver end-to-end services and solutions with our deep industry expertise and strong partner ecosystem, leveraging our capabilities across strategy, technology, design, engineering and business operations. The Group reported 2025 global revenues of €22.5 billion.
